Bien-Aimé Lincoln, BLTS agent murdered in Croix des Bouquets on his birthday

CTN News

A graduating student in Psychology at the Faculty of Ethnology of the State University of Haiti, Bien-Aimé Lincoln, agent of the Brigade for the Fight against Drug Trafficking (BLTS) was murdered by bandits in Croix-des-Bouquets this Thursday, December 2, 2022, ZoomHaitiNews has learned.

The police officer, in his thirties, was murdered the same day he was born, and his corpse was taken away by the thugs.

Belonging to the 28th promotion of the Haitian National Police, the father of a little boy leaves his police peers and fellow students in shock.

It should be noted that Bien-Aimé Lincoln has escaped several times from assassination attempts in the area, according to information received by ZoomHaitiNews. Unfortunately, he could not survive this last one, which adds to the list of murdered police officers in 2022.
While the PNH has just announced changes in its chain of command, cases of kidnapping and spectacular assassinations continue to haunt the lives of the population in recent days, under the complicit and cynical gaze of the government led by de facto Prime Minister Ariel Henry.

This new assassination of the agent of the Brigade for the Fight against Drug Trafficking (BLTS) coincides with the announcement by the U.S. Treasury Department of sanctions against Senators Rony Celestin and Hervé Foucand for drug trafficking and fueling insecurity in Haiti.
